Knights Inn Paris is a lodging, located at 409 Tyson Ave, Paris, Tennessee, 38242, United States of America, Paris (TN), 38242, United States
Location :
409 Tyson Ave, Paris, Tennessee, 38242 of America, Paris (TN), 38242
Added by
Jopie, at 01 January 2020